Olaf Lipinski PhD Thesis Dataset/Code
This dataset contains the code bases for every chapter of the thesis, including instructions on how to run them.
The code bases present are:
Code for the Temporal Progression Games - accompanying our paper "Speaking Your Language: Spatial Relationships in Interpretable Emergent Communication". This code allows for analysis of spatial relationships in emergent communication.
Code for the Temporal Referential Games - accompanying our paper "It’s About Time: Temporal References in Emergent Communication". This code provides a new architecture and dataset for Emergent Communication research. We introduce a variant of the well-known referential games, where we include a temporal aspect to the communication. This is done through skewing the target distribution to include target repetitions at random intervals. Through this, we aim to study how and when temporal references can emerge between agents.
Code for the Emergent Communication in Werewolf - accompanying our paper "Emergent Password Signalling in the Game of Werewolf". This code analyses the impact of communication time and voting plurality in Emergent Communication in the game of Werewolf.
Code for emlangkit - A toolkit that aims to collect all metrics currently used in emergent communication research into one place. The usage should be convenient and the inputs should be standardised, to ease adoption and spread of these metrics.
